The multiplicity distributions and correlations of grey track producing par
ticles (N-g), black track producing particles (N-b) and heavy track produci
ng particles (N-h) have been studied in 60 A (GeVO)-O-16 induced nuclear em
ulsion reaction. The multiplicity distributions of grey particles,black par
ticles and heavy track producing particles can be reproduced by FRITIOF (ve
rsion 1.7) taking cascade mechanism into account and DTUNUC 2.0 with an inc
ident energy of 200 A GeV. The mean multiplicity of black particles <N-b> i
ncreases with the number of grey particle N-g up to 10 and then exhibits a
saturation for peripheral,central and mini-bias events;the average values o
f grey particles <N-g> (heavy track producing particles <N-h>) increase wit
h increasing values of black particle N-b (grey particle N-g).
